NEW GLASGOW – Alan Wendall “Demp” Murray, age 78, of New Glasgow and formerly of Trenton, passed away Thursday, June 20, 2013 in the Aberdeen Hospital surrounded by family.
Born in Hillside, he was a son of the late Hector and Laura (Fanning) Murray.
He was retired from the Nova Scotia Power Generating Plant, Trenton. In sports, Demp was part of the Trenton Jr.’s ’51-’52 Maritime Jr. Hockey Championship Team and a member of the ’61-’62 Maritime Softball Championship team. He coached minor ball and minor hockey for several years, served as President of Trenton Minor Hockey and was also one of the original members of the committee who oversaw the construction of the Trenton Rink. He was a member of the Pictou County Sports Heritage Hall of Fame. An avid bowler and golfer, he was a member of Abercrombie Golf Club for 50 years. He was a member of the Pictou County Prostate Cancer Support Association and a former member of the Elks Club.
